Endpoint
Urinary albumin excretion rate

Method
Albumin excreted per unit time from a timed urine collection (overnight or 24-hour), assayed immunoturbidimetrically or immunonephelometrically and expressed as micrograms per minute. Collection interval and completeness check recorded on the edge.
The method is part of the endpoint identity. Studies measuring the same quantity by a different method are held as separate endpoints.
Notes
Confused with urinary microalbumin reported as a concentration (mg/L) and with the albumin-to-creatinine ratio (mg/g or mg/mmol). All three are called 'microalbuminuria' in abstracts, but only this one is normalised by time: a concentration moves with hydration and urine flow when nothing renal has changed, and a creatinine ratio moves with muscle mass. Merging them mixes units and produces a pooled estimate with no interpretable scale. Also distinct from 24-hour urinary protein excretion, which counts total protein in grams and is an order of magnitude coarser.
